Raspberry Cheesecake Parfait

As you may already know, skipping a dessert might not always be good for your health as there are plenty of reasons we all crave for it; the point is to find the right way to replace all the unhealthy ingredients with natural alternatives that can nourish both your body and mind.
Time to present these top-listed jars full of deliciousness! A healthier and no-bake version of your favourite dessert, extra low in fat that maintains the magical “cheesecake feeling”.
In less than 15 minutes you’ll have this “red and white beauty” ready to enjoy with no guilt! Cause a light snack during the day can instantly change your mood and boost up your energy! 😎

dsc_0406

Total time: 15′

Ingredients: (serves 4)

1 cup fresh or frozen raspberries
1 cup 0% thick greek yogurt
1/2 cup 0% cream cheese
1 cup granola (low fat & sugarfree)
8 brazilian nuts
3 tbsp lemon juice
3 tbsp honey

2 tsp salt

img_3619

Method: (Super easy..!)

1.  Blend the granola and add the crumbs to the bottom of the jar (use a spoon to pack it down firmly)

img_3717

2.  For the cheesy mixture, add in to a food processor the yogurt, nuts, lemon, honey and salt and blend till smooth; then place it over the crumbs

img_3817

3.  Finally, compress the raspberries and top them at the last layer of the jar

img_3955-1

* Garnish with all kinds of berries; blueberries, raspberries, blackberries, cranberries etc., some fresh leaves of mint and coconut chips! *

Blueberry Banana Bread

Already tired of eating every single day your typical and in fact basic whole wheat bread? Spice up your life with this alternative “bread” recipe that’s filled with fresh blueberries and, trust me, you won’t be disappointed! The replacement of oil to bananas allows you to cut back on the fat and enjoy your snack with no guilt! Keep in mind that it’s naturally sweetened with fruit and honey but the moist is still there due to the consistency of juicy blueberries. Perfect for an energy-filled breakfast or even for a light and on-the-go snack during the day. Give it a try; delicious but in the same time healthy and super-easy to make..! 😉

IMG_9638.jpg
Prep time: 5′
Cook time: 40′

Ingredients: (makes a loaf)

1 1/4 cup whole wheat flour
2 bananas (mashed)
1/2 cup wild blueberries
2 tbsp honey
3 tbsp nonfat Greek yogurt
1 egg (optional)
2 tsp baking powder
2 tsp vanilla extract
1 pinch of salt

img_9358

Method:

  1.  Preheat the oven to 160°C
  2.  In a medium bowl whisk together the flour, baking powder and salt
  3.  In a separate bowl whisk together the egg and 2 teaspoons of vanilla extract
  4.  Stir in the mashed bananas, yogurt and honey
  5.  Add your new mixture in the flour-bowl and stir until incorporated
  6.  Gently fold the blueberries into the batter, and the mixture is now ready!

img_9412

7.  Spread the batter into the prepared pan and bake at 160°C for 40′

Peanut Butter Energy Bites

No bake & really easy to make! In less than 10 minutes of preparation these delicious and guilt-free energy bites are gonna give you the right boost to keep you going through the day. The best energy-filled snack for you to have before your workout session or even for your breakfast. Good for a quick snack and undoubtedly the best cure for your late night cravings. Don’t forget that healthy snacks like these should always be included into your daily eating habits.

They might taste more like a dessert but keep in mind that they’re loaded with protein, fiber and lots of healthy fats. Are you ready to get away from your everyday snacking routine and try something… different? 😉

Peanut butter energy bites healthy snack food.jpgTotal time: 10′

Ingredients: (makes about 25 bites)

2/3 cup creamy peanut butter
1 cup old-fashioned oats
1/2 cup chocolate chips
1/2 cup ground flax seeds
1/2 cup toasted coconut flakes (optional)

2 tbsp honey

Peanut butter energy bites healthy snack food preparation.jpg

Method: (suuuper easy!)

1.  Combine all 5 ingredients into a medium bowl

peanut-butter-energy-bites-healthy-snack-food-cooking-ingredients

  2.  Stir until they’re thoroughly mixed

  3.  Cover and let freeze for 10’ so that they’re easier to roll (optional)

  4.  Start rolling..!!

peanut-butter-energy-bites-healthy-snack-food-modern-design

Bon Appétit…!!😎

peanut-butter-energy-bites-healthy-snack-photo

You can store them in your refrigerator for up to a week!

Coconut Black Rice Pudding

I have to admit it. I’m not a big fan of rice pudding, but when it comes to a coconut-included recipe I just can’t resist.
Some days ago I was out for brunch so I decided to have a Black Rice Pudding dish which I was told that is a traditional Thai dessert, also known as “kao neow dahm”. I had NO idea what that meant, but the thing is that it was truly delicious and in fact it inspired me to make my own recipe at home.
Super easy, gluten-free and veeeery coconut-ty! Great for a quick and healthy breakfast, brunch or even a dessert. Creamy, sweet & fruity. It will surely amaze you and give you a rush of good energy…!

IMG_7331.jpgPrep time: 5′
Cook time: 20′

Ingredients: (serves 4)
1 cup black rice
1 cup coconut milk
1/2 cup water
2 tbsp maple syrup
1 tbsp brown sugar (optional)
1 pinch of salt

Fruits, nuts and seeds to accompany your pudding: mango, passion fruit, pomegranate, banana, strawberries, pineapple, coconut flakes, goji berries

img_6677

Method:

1.  Place rice in a medium saucepan and mix with coconut milk, sugar, salt and the indicated amount of water
2. Boil until the rice is tender and most of the liquid has been absorbed
3. Add the maple syrup and stir
4. Remove from heat and set aside while you prepare your toppings

img_6775

*Top it with some chopped fruit and a sprinkle of nuts to increase the amount of protein.

img_6781

5.  Place the pudding into a bowl and cover it with your desired toppings

img_7025

6.  Serve and pour over a small amount of warmed coconut milk and maple syrup

Açaí Bowl

Welcoming June with these delicious & refreshing tropical Αçaí Βowls…! Wild-harvested from the heart of the Amazon, açaí berries (pronounced “ah-sa-ee”), are considered to be one of the top ranked superfoods, due to their incredible antioxidant properties. This is basically the alternative South American recipe for a more special and interesting thick berry smoothie, enjoyed with a spoon and topped with a whole host of nutritious ingredients. And here’s where the real fun begins! The options for your toppings can be only limited by your own imagination!…
You find it crazy? Don’t be skeptical! This superfood açaí bowl will give you the absolute boost to get you going through the day. Just give it a try; I guess there must be a good reason for them becoming nowadays so trendy and gaining a notable popularity worldwide!!

IMG_9618
Prep time: 5′

Ingredients: (makes 1 bowl)

1 frozen banana
1 cup fresh strawberries
1/2 cup unsweetened almond milk

2 tbsp of açaí berry powder

IMG_9100

Plus our toppings

IMG_9230

Açaí Berry Powder

Method: (suuuper easy!)
  1. Put all the ingredients into a blender and blend until smooth
  2. Pour the smoothie mixture into a bowl
  3. Top with desired ingredients
  4. Serve and Enjoy! 😀

IMG_9726

My toppings:
Chia seeds
Goji berries
Raspberries
Coconut
Banana
Kiwi, and…

Avocado Brownies

I know it’s not the right time to post about these hard-to-resist chocolate fudgy brownies and interrupt you from your summer diet plans but I’ve got the the perfect recipe for you!
😎
Try making your favourite and of course guilt-free chocolate brownies by replacing oil or butter with avocados which are loaded with fiber, healthy fats, minerals and more than 20 vitamins.
It may sound strange at first but avocado, with its consistency of healthy fats and creamy texture can incredibly convert your favourite recipe to this delicious, nearly sinless and easy-to-make nutritious dessert!

IMG_8338Prep time: 10′
Cook time: 25′

Ingredients: (makes 10-12)

2 medium avocados (or 1 large)
1/2 cup cocoa powder
1/2 cup coconut flour
1/2 cup honey or maple syrup
1 tsp vanilla extract
1 tsp baking soda

3 eggs

IMG_7619

Method:

  1.  Preheat oven to 175℃

  2.  In a blender combine avocados, maple syrup and vanilla

IMG_7693

3.  Place the mixture into a bowl and whisk in the 3 eggs

  4.  Add flour, cocoa powder and baking soda and stir until the batter is smooth

IMG_7837

  5.  Grease your baking dish with some coconut oil, pour the batter and bake for about 25 minutes

  6.  Let them cool completely and finally cut equally into pieces!

Cucumber Gin&Tonic Pops

I’m not complaining, but let’s face it. Summer heat came waaay too early this year!!

So, I came down with a super easy and refreshing cocktail recipe that’s gonna surprise you and get you more and more into the mood.

Gin & Tonic fan? Introducing the most summerish and delicious Cucumber Gin & Tonic Frozen Popsicles! The coolest way to fuel summer fun and start your favorite session in style! 😎

IMG_6417

Thumbs Up!

Ingredients: (makes 10)

3 cups tonic water
2 shots of gin
1 lime, juiced
1/2 cup cucumber slices
IMG_6101

Method:
 

1.  Mix together gin, tonic, brown sugar and lime juice

IMG_6154

2.  Place cucumber slices into popsicle moulds
3.  Pour in the tonic mix

 4. Freeze overnight and enjoy!!

IMG_6347 (1)

P.S. Add some mint leaves for extra flavor!

Soufflé au Chocolat!

Nutella lover? Soufflé lover? The perfect combo: introducing the heavenly Soufflé de Nutella!

Be sure that a hot and well-risen soufflé, fresh from the oven, will always delight your guests. But in this case, when Nutella shows up, trust me, everybody’s gonna truuuly fall for it!!

Remember: It’s ALL about timing! You have to take them out of the oven just at the right moment. The center should be still molten and gooey, though the texture fluffy and airy. When ready, sprinkle them with a dusting of powdered sugar and of course serve them à la minute!

P.S. Despite its reputation, this dessert is actually quick & easy to make! It always works.

IMG_5212Total time: 25’
Serves: 4

Ingredients:
2 eggs
1 tsp sugar
Butter
Cocoa powder

1/2 cup of Nutella

Just give it a try. . . !

 

IMG_4898

Method:

  1.   Preheat the oven to 190C

  2.   You will need 2 bowls.
          Bowl 1: Mix the Nutella with egg yolks
          Bowl 2: Beat egg whites with sugar till stiff

IMG_4942
Bowl 1 & 2

IMG_5002

3.  Combine the 2 mixtures using a spatula

IMG_5087

4.  Grease the ramequins with butter and lightly dust them with some cocoa powder

IMG_5149

5.  Evenly distribute the mixture into the ramequins

IMG_5165

6.  Finally, bake for 15 to 17 minutes and SERVE IMMEDIATELY!!!

Hawaiian Green Smoothie

After trying many different recipes for the “perfect” green smoothie, I finally ended up with my favourite one that provides plenty of nutrients and vitamins combined with an amazing taste. It’s something that can naturally boost your energy and improve your way of living.

Introducing my beloved “Hawaiian Green Smoothie” recipe that can actually be enjoyed either as a wake-up tonic or an afternoon refresher.

Trust me, it’s “rawesome” and aaall you need to get started is a blender!

IMG_4485

Total time: 5′ (serves 1)

Here are the INGREDIENTS that are gonna supercharge your smoothie:

2 clementines, peeled
1 banana
2 cups spinach
1/2 cup frozen pineapple chunks
1/2 cup water

2 tbsp flaxseeds

IMG_4190

Method:

 1.  Peel and cut in small slices all of the ingredients

IMG_4231

Preps

IMG_4281

2.  Combine them into the blender in the following order

(PSST!! Add some ice too!)
IMG_4339

3.  Blend until smooth

IMG_4415

4.  Pour into a mason jar and GET READY to enjoy!! 😃

Love Cookies

Surprise your Valentine with the most tempting cookies in the whole world; butter cookies. It’s an extremely easy and yummy recipe so just try make some time for it.

As it’s February, the month of love, I decided to heart-shape them and decorate them with all of my love. 😋 So… Simple and cute butter cookies, all topped with royal icing. Couldn’t be better!

IMG_1091

Preparation time: 20’
Cook: 20’

Ingredients: (makes 45 mini or 22 large cookies)

220g butter, chilled
150g white sugar
270g all-purpose flour
50g custard powder
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 egg

Here’s everything you’ll need . . . 

IMG_0736

Method:

1.  Put the butter and sugar in a food processor and pulse until the mixture looks like fine breadcrumbs

IMG_0758

2.  Add flour, custard powder, vanilla extract and the egg and mix thoroughly

IMG_0834

3.  On a lightly floured surface, bring the dough together and form it into 2 flat rounds

4.  Wrap in cling films and chill for 30’, while you preheat the oven to 160C

IMG_0854

5.  Now roll the dough rounds out on a floured surface and shape them with a cookie cutter. When ready, lay them on a baking tray lined with baking paper.

IMG_0869

6.  Finally, bake at 160C for 20 minutes while you prepare the toppings!

For the Royal Icing you’ll need:

2 cups of powdered sugar
The whites of 2 eggs
2 teaspoons of lemon juice
And of course, some food colouring

IMG_0976

Don’t panic, it’s easy:

  • In a large bowl combine the egg whites and lemon juice and start mixing
  • Add powdered sugar gradually and mix until incorporated
  • And now just add some food colouring, if desired…
